Your complete guide to visiting Koutammakou, Benin
Nestled in northern Benin, Koutammakou is a UNESCO-listed landscape famed for its dramatic clay towers and Batammarí culture. Explore ancient towers, learn local customs, and savor savannah evenings.
Dramatic, sun-kissed tower villages crafted from adobe, forming a surreal skyline that reveals Batammarí engineering and resilience.
Meet living artisans, hear legends, and learn daily life within the UNESCO-listed settlements.
Wide savannah, seasonal rains, and clay towers frame sunset photography and peaceful strolls.
